From 36b79ac47303d2883d4aeca8f607e70cc38fb2d9 Mon Sep 17 00:00:00 2001 From: Robert Varga Date: Fri, 17 Apr 2015 12:27:50 +0200 Subject: [PATCH] Expose ResolveDataChangeEventsTask ListenerTree is already visible from implementation, this is a utility class for taking advantage of this functionality. Change-Id: Ia75d90f3729afb112da48264d5552fc3b0cb1d37 Signed-off-by: Robert Varga --- .../md/sal/dom/store/impl/ResolveDataChangeEventsTask.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/opendaylight/md-sal/sal-inmemory-datastore/src/main/java/org/opendaylight/controller/md/sal/dom/store/impl/ResolveDataChangeEventsTask.java b/opendaylight/md-sal/sal-inmemory-datastore/src/main/java/org/opendaylight/controller/md/sal/dom/store/impl/ResolveDataChangeEventsTask.java index fb4931098b..07a9fb7a88 100644 --- a/opendaylight/md-sal/sal-inmemory-datastore/src/main/java/org/opendaylight/controller/md/sal/dom/store/impl/ResolveDataChangeEventsTask.java +++ b/opendaylight/md-sal/sal-inmemory-datastore/src/main/java/org/opendaylight/controller/md/sal/dom/store/impl/ResolveDataChangeEventsTask.java @@ -7,6 +7,7 @@ */ package org.opendaylight.controller.md.sal.dom.store.impl; +import com.google.common.annotations.Beta; import com.google.common.base.Optional; import com.google.common.base.Preconditions; import com.google.common.collect.ArrayListMultimap; @@ -34,7 +35,8 @@ import org.slf4j.LoggerFactory; * Computes data change events for all affected registered listeners in data * tree. */ -final class ResolveDataChangeEventsTask { +@Beta +public final class ResolveDataChangeEventsTask { private static final Logger LOG = LoggerFactory.getLogger(ResolveDataChangeEventsTask.class); private final DataTreeCandidate candidate; @@ -42,7 +44,7 @@ final class ResolveDataChangeEventsTask { private Multimap, DOMImmutableDataChangeEvent> collectedEvents; - public ResolveDataChangeEventsTask(final DataTreeCandidate candidate, final ListenerTree listenerTree) { + private ResolveDataChangeEventsTask(final DataTreeCandidate candidate, final ListenerTree listenerTree) { this.candidate = Preconditions.checkNotNull(candidate); this.listenerRoot = Preconditions.checkNotNull(listenerTree); } -- 2.36.6